Make a real impact in the lives of students across elementary, middle, and high school settings as a certified Speech-Language Pathologist on a contract basis near Littleton, CO. This role provides a rewarding opportunity to support school-aged children in developing critical communication skills and achieving their academic goals.

Key Qualifications:

  • Active SLP license in Colorado, or eligibility to obtain one
  • Certification as a Speech-Language Pathologist (CCC preferred, but open to CFs with strong mentoring)
  • Experience working with students at elementary, middle, and/or high school levels
  • Familiarity with IEP development, progress monitoring, and educational documentation requirements
  • Strong communication and collaboration abilities with students, staff, and families
  • Capacity to manage a diverse caseload and adapt to changing school environments

Role Responsibilities:

  • Conduct screenings, evaluations, and assessments for students referred for speech-language services
  • Develop and implement individual therapy plans targeting articulation, fluency, voice, language, and social communication needs
  • Provide direct therapy, both individually and in small groups, adjusting approaches based on student strengths and challenges
  • Collaborate closely with teachers, counselors, and special education staff to support student success in academic and social settings
  • Attend IEP meetings, contribute to eligibility determinations, and assist with compliance and documentation
  • Communicate effectively with families, sharing progress and strategies for home support
  • Maintain accurate records and ensure timely completion of all reports
